
Urgent Rescue Mission Underway for Entangled Whale off Sydney Coast
Sydney, Australia – A race against time is underway to save a humpback whale entangled in fishing gear near Sydney Harbour. Satellite images captured on Saturday first alerted authorities to the whale's plight, showing the animal struggling with a rope and buoy attached to its left fin. A team of scientists and ecologists are now working tirelessly to locate and free the whale. "The whale appears to be in distress," stated Dr. Emily Carter, a marine biologist involved in the rescue. "The entanglement could severely restrict its movement and ability to feed, potentially leading to serious health consequences." The video footage, shared by ABC, shows the whale's labored movements in the water. The rescue operation is a complex undertaking, requiring careful coordination and specialized equipment to safely remove the gear without further harming the animal.
